Last updated: 2024 Jun 14Morning
Start your day with a visit to the ancient city of Mycenae, a UNESCO World Heritage site. Explore the ruins of the ancient city and learn about its fascinating history.
Afternoon
After visiting Mycenae, head to the picturesque town of Nafplio. Take a stroll through the old town, admire the neoclassical architecture, and visit the Palamidi Fortress for spectacular views of the town and the sea.
Morning
Today, visit the ancient theater of Epidaurus, another UNESCO World Heritage site. Admire the impressive acoustics of the theater and learn about its history.
Afternoon
After visiting the theater, head to the charming seaside town of Porto Heli. Relax on the beach, go for a swim, or take a boat trip to the nearby island of Spetses.
Morning
Explore the historic town of Monemvasia, known as the "Gibraltar of the East". Walk through the narrow streets of the old town and admire the Byzantine architecture.
Afternoon
After visiting Monemvasia, head to the nearby town of Gythio. Take a walk along the seafront promenade, visit the island of Kranai, or relax on one of the town's beaches.
Morning
Today, visit the ancient site of Olympia, another UNESCO World Heritage site. Explore the ruins of the ancient city and see the famous Olympic Stadium.
Afternoon
After visiting Olympia, head to the town of Pyrgos. Take a walk through the old town, visit the Archaeological Museum, or sample some local wine at one of the town's wineries.
Morning
Visit the historic town of Nemea, known for its ancient vineyards and wine production. Take a tour of one of the town's wineries, sample some local wine, and learn about the history of wine production in the region.
Afternoon
After visiting Nemea, head to the seaside town of Loutraki. Relax on the beach, go for a swim, or visit the town's famous thermal baths.
